Irresistible Tiramisu Brownies with 2 Coffee Layers

Media 22 3 Recipe Irresistible Tiramisu Brownies with 2 Coffee Layers

Rich, fudgy brownies infused with coffee and topped with a creamy mascarpone layer — the best of tiramisu and brownies in one bite.

📋 Recipe Card

Servings & Timing

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 25 minutes
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 12 servings
  • Author: Judy Wilson
  • Diet: Vegetarian

🛒 Ingredients

  • 1 cup unsalted butter
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s (room temp)
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• ½ cup cocoa powder
  • ¼ tsp salt
  • 2 tbsp instant coffee granules
  • ½ cup strong brewed coffee
  • 1 cup mascarpone cheese
  • ¼ cup pow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p cocoa powder (for dusting)

👩‍🍳 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Set o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king pan.
  2. Make Batter: Melt butter in a saucepan. Stir in sugar, eggs, and vanilla until smooth.
  3. Add Dry Mix: Sift flour, cocoa powder, and salt. Fold into wet mixture.
  4. Add Coffee: Dissolve instant coffee in brewed coffee. Mix into batter.
  5. Bake: Spread batter evenly in the prepared pan. Bake for 25 minutes. Cool completely.
  6. Mascarpone Layer: Beat mascarpone and powdered sugar until creamy. Spread over cooled brownies.
  7. Finish: Dust with cocoa powder. Slice and serve chilled.

🌟 Notes & Tips

  • Use room-temperature eggs for a smoother batter.
  • Let brownies cool fully before adding mascarpone to prevent melting.
  • Store leftovers covered in the fridge for up to 3 days.

☕ Ingredient Insights & Substitutions

  • Coffee: Strong brewed coffee + instant coffee = bold, authentic flavor. Espresso works too.
  • Mascarpone: Can be swapped with cream cheese for a tangier twist.
  • Flour: Use cake flour for a slightly lighter texture.
  • Cocoa Powder: Dutch-process cocoa deepens the chocolate flavor.

🍽 Variations & Serving Ideas

  • Tiramisu-Style Layers: Brush the baked brownie with extra coffee before adding mascarpone.
  • Boozy Version: Add 1 tbsp coffee liqueur (like Kahlúa) to the mascarpone mix.
  • Mini Desserts: Bake in a muffin tin for individual brownie cups.
  • Extra Indulgence: Top with shaved dark chocolate or chocolate-covered espresso beans.

🥡 Storage & Make Ahead

  • Refrigerator: Store in an airtight container up to 3 days.
  • Freezer: Freeze brownies (without mascarpone) for up to 2 months. Add topping after thawing.
  • Make Ahead: Bake brownies a day before and add mascarpone layer before serving.

❓ FAQs

Q: Can I use decaf coffee?
Yes — it gives the same flavor without the caffeine.

Q: Can I skip the mascarpone layer?
Sure, but you’ll miss the tiramisu vibe. The brownies alone are still fudgy and delicious.

Q: How do I cut clean slices?
Chill brownies for at least 1 hour and wipe your knife between cuts.
